Manage packages with dpkg
__package_dpkg is used on Debian and variants (like Ubuntu) to install packages that are provided locally as
*
.deb files.
The object given to __package_dpkg must be the name of the deb package.
*.deb package
# Install foo and bar packages __package_dpkg --source /tmp/foo_0.1_all.deb foo_0.1_all.deb __package_dpkg --source $__type/files/bar_1.4.deb bar_1.4.deb
